LaserPerformance College Sailing Singlehanded National Championships Set to Begin in Michigan


HOLLAND, MICH. (October 31, 2018) – The LaserPerformance Men’s and Women’s Singlehanded National Championships, hosted by Grand Valley State University and Hope College at the Macatawa Bay Yacht Club and Macatawa Bay Junior Association in Holland, Michigan are set to begin Friday, November 2nd with registration, boat assignment and a competitors meeting. Racing will take place Saturday, November 3rd and Sunday, November 4th.
 
The championships include the top 18 men and 18 women singlehanded sailors in the nation. At least one male and female sailor has qualified from each of the seven collegiate sailing conferences to compete in this prestigious event. The regatta will take place out of the Macatawa Bay Yacht Club and Macatawa Bay Junior Association in Holland, Mich. The sailors will compete on the west end of Lake Macatawa or on Lake Michigan south of the Holland Channel, weather dependent.

LaserPerformance is providing a fleet of full rig Lasers for the men’s event and a fleet of Laser Radials for the women’s event with sails. Marlow Ropes, the Official Rope Sponsor of College Sailing, and a supporting sponsor of the regatta are also providing mainsheets.
 
The men will be competing for the Glen S. Foster Trophy, awarded to the first place finisher. The trophy is given in appreciation of Glen S. Foster for his interest in collegiate sailing and devotion to singlehanded competition, particularly in the Finn class. The second place finisher in the men’s event will receive the George Griswold Trophy, given in honor of George Griswold for more than three decades of service to intercollegiate sailing as long time Graduate Secretary of MCSA, former ICSA Secretary, ICSA Eligibility Chairman, and member of the ICSA Hall of Fame.

The women will be competing for the Janet Lutz Trophy, awarded to the first place finisher, in honor of the former Athletic Director at Pembroke College who played a major role in the early growth of New England women’s sailing.
 
Competitors will report at 1 p.m. on Friday for registration and boat assignment followed by a Competitors Briefing at 5 p.m. at the Macatawa Bay Junior Association. The first warning for racing is set for Saturday at 10 a.m. A regatta dinner will be held Saturday evening for the competitors, coaches and guests at 6 p.m. Racing will continue Sunday with a 10 a.m. first warning and no race will start after 3 p.m. on Sunday.

The Inter-Collegiate Sailing Association (ICSA) is the governing authority for sailing competition at colleges and universities throughout the United States and in some parts of Canada. Visit www.collegesailing.org to learn more.
